         All credit goes to the Old Nalandians Sports Club,
         which  volunteered  to  organize  the  first  tourna-
         ment on 3rd and 4th September 1999 at Camp-
         bell Park. All the spade work   including the art
         work for the Trophies was done  by the  Old
         Nalandian’s Sports Club, leaving the main guide
         lines on running the tournament to the rest of the
         organizations to follow. The tournament regularly
